summaryrefslogtreecommitdiff
path: root/p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ch
diff options
context:
space:
mode:
authorRobert Hensing <robert@roberthensing.nl>2025-05-28 16:40:27 +0200
committerRobert Hensing <robert@roberthensing.nl>2025-05-28 16:40:27 +0200
commit510d273b37ac28813b752585262dd4bae6552ded (patch)
tree775549db787f0c9727f79e369c235beaf37d8e0b /p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ch
parent1bcbf9e0a8811c218c74e372ff505ffe534bc61d (diff)
mkDerivation: Call functor when __functor is passed
Considering that no attribute value passed to mkDerivation was allowed to be a function anyway, this does not cause any changes for code that used the previous interpretation of __functor, because that could wouldn't have worked anyway. In practice, this fixes a problem when an option value from `lib.types.functionTo` is passed as an argument here. (`functionTo` returns a `lib.setFunctionArgs` result, which is a __functor)
Diffstat (limited to 'p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ch')
0 files changed, 0 insertions, 0 deletions